วิธีการบล็อก Bots ที่ไม่ดีใน WordPress: แนวทางในการต่อสู้กับสแปมจากการโจมตีไซต์ของคุณและเน้นเซิร์ฟเวอร์ของคุณ

บอตที่ไม่ดีนั้นเป็นการสิ้นเปลืองทรัพยากรของเซิร์ฟเวอร์และสามารถบิดเบือนข้อมูล Google Analytics ได้.


การบล็อกบอทที่ไม่ดีใน WordPress สามารถทำให้ไซต์ของคุณเร็วขึ้นและป้องกันไม่ให้บอทไร้ประโยชน์เข้าชมเว็บไซต์ของคุณอย่างต่อเนื่อง คุณจะไม่มีทางรู้ว่าบอทสแปมกำลังเข้าชมไซต์ของคุณหรือไม่ถ้าคุณไม่ตรวจสอบ ในบทช่วยสอนนี้ฉันจะแสดงวิธีค้นหา บอทที่ไม่ดี ใช้ Wordfence จากนั้นปิดกั้นโดยใช้ Wordfence กฎไฟร์วอลล์ Cloudflare หรือปลั๊กอิน Blackhole For Bad Bots.

ฉันไม่แนะนำ Wordfence เพราะมันอาจเป็นปลั๊กอินที่ช้า กฎไฟร์วอลล์ของ Cloudflare อนุญาตให้คุณบล็อก 5 บอท (พร้อมแผนฟรี) ซึ่งเป็นจุดเริ่มต้นที่ยอดเยี่ยมสำหรับเว็บไซต์ WordPress ส่วนใหญ่และปลั๊กอิน Blackhole สำหรับ Bad Bots ควรบล็อกบอทสแปมทั้งหมดที่ไม่ปฏิบัติตามกฎที่ไม่ปฏิบัติตาม.

บอทที่แย่คืออะไรและทำไมฉันควรบล็อกพวกเขา?

บอทที่ไม่ดีคือบอทใด ๆ ที่เข้ามาที่เว็บไซต์ของคุณโดยไม่เกิดประโยชน์กับคุณ บอทเหล่านี้ใช้ทรัพยากรของเซิร์ฟเวอร์โดยเฉพาะอย่างยิ่งหากพวกเขาเข้าชมเว็บไซต์ของคุณหรือหน้า wp-login มากเกินไป การบล็อกพวกเขาอาจทำให้เซิร์ฟเวอร์ของคุณมีความเครียดน้อยลงและอาจช่วยลดแบนด์วิดท์ของคุณโฮสติ้งต้นทุนและเพิ่มความเร็วไซต์ของคุณ วิธีนี้สามารถป้องกันไม่ให้บอตที่ไม่ดีปรากฏในข้อมูล Google Analytics ของคุณ.

1. ติดตั้ง Wordfence

Wordfence แสดงบอททั้งหมดให้คุณกดปุ่มเว็บไซต์ของคุณแบบเรียลไทม์.

คุณไม่จำเป็นต้องเปิดใช้งานปลั๊กอินนี้อย่างถาวร เราจะใช้รายงานการเข้าชมสดของมันอย่างเคร่งครัดเพื่อระบุว่าบอทใดกำลังเข้าชมไซต์ของคุณและควรจะบล็อกหรือไม่ เมื่อเราทราบบ็อตที่ไม่ดีเราสามารถบล็อคมันได้โดยไม่ต้องออกจาก Wordfence ติดตั้ง.

Wordfence ความปลอดภัยปลั๊กอิน

2. ดูรายงานสภาพการจราจรสดของคุณ

ไปที่ Wordfence →เครื่องมือ→การจราจรสด.

รายงานสภาพการจราจรสด แสดงบอททั้งหมดที่เข้าชมไซต์ของคุณแบบเรียลไทม์.

Wordfence-Live-จราจรแท็บ

3. ระบุบอทที่ไม่ดีเยี่ยมชมเว็บไซต์ของคุณ

สังเกตรายงานการจราจรสดของคุณสักครู่เพื่อดูว่าบอทที่น่าสงสัยใด ๆ กำลังเข้าชมไซต์ของคุณซ้ำ ๆ หรือไม่ ทำรายการชื่อโฮสต์ของพวกเขา (แสดงใน Wordfence) จากนั้น Google ชื่อโฮสต์ของพวกเขาเพื่อดูว่าคนอื่นรายงานว่าพวกเขารายงานว่าเป็นบอตที่ไม่ดี (คุณจะต้องทำการวิจัยและตรวจสอบว่าเป็นบอทสแปมจริง ๆ ) Googlebot และบ็อตที่ถูกต้องตามกฎหมายอื่น ๆ นั้นใช้ได้และไม่ควรถูกบล็อก แต่คอยดูสิ่งที่น่าสงสัยและเพิ่มเข้าไปในรายการของคุณ.

สดการจราจรรายงาน Wordfence

หลังจากสร้างรายการชื่อโฮสต์สแปมบอททั้งหมดของคุณคุณมีตัวเลือกน้อยสำหรับการปิดกั้นพวกเขา ฉันแนะนำปลั๊กอิน Blackhole For Bad Bots เนื่องจากเป็นแบบอัตโนมัติและจะบล็อกบอทที่ไม่ดีใหม่ในอนาคต (ซึ่งอาจไม่อยู่ในรายการของคุณ) หรือถ้าคุณมีบอทสแปมเพียงไม่กี่ตัวที่เข้าชมไซต์ของคุณ (สูงสุด 5 ชื่อโฮสต์) คุณสามารถใช้กฎไฟร์วอลล์ของ Cloudflare Wordfence นั้นยอดเยี่ยมในการปิดกั้นบอทที่ไม่ดี แต่ตัวปลั๊กอินนั้นสามารถทำให้เว็บไซต์ WordPress ทำงานช้า.

4. บล็อกบอทที่ไม่ดีด้วย Wordfence

Wordfence มีตัวเลือกการบล็อกที่หลากหลายสำหรับการบล็อกบ็อตที่ไม่ดี แต่ตัวปลั๊กอินสามารถทำให้เว็บไซต์ WordPress ของคุณช้าลงเล็กน้อยและคุณอาจเสี่ยงต่อการถูกบล็อกมนุษย์ / ซอฟต์แวร์รวบรวมข้อมูลหากปลั๊กอินนั้นไม่ได้รับการกำหนดค่าอย่างถูกต้อง ใช้ Wordfence เฉพาะเมื่อคุณสะดวกสบายในการกำหนดค่า.

บล็อกบอทที่ไม่ดีโดยชื่อโฮสต์

  • ไปที่ การตั้งค่าการบล็อก และสร้างกฎการบล็อก
  • เพิ่มชื่อโฮสต์ของบอตที่ไม่ดีที่คุณต้องการบล็อก
  • ใช้ ดอกจัน (ดังแสดงด้านล่าง) เพื่อป้องกันการเปลี่ยนแปลงทั้งหมดของบอทนั้น
  • สร้างกฎการบล็อกชื่อโฮสต์ ธ ปท. ที่ไม่ดีทั้งหมดจากรายงานการเข้าชมสดของคุณ

Wordfence ปิดกั้น-กฎ

บล็อกบอทที่ไม่ดีด้วยการ จำกัด อัตรา

  • ไปที่ Wordfence →ไฟร์วอลล์→ การ จำกัด อัตรา
  • กำหนดการตั้งค่าเพื่อ จำกัด “ คำขอ” และ“ หน้าที่ดู” โดยโปรแกรมรวบรวมข้อมูล
  • ระวังอย่าปิดกั้นบ็อต / คนที่ถูกกฎหมายที่ไม่ปฏิบัติตามกฎการ จำกัด อัตราของคุณ

Wordfence- จำกัด อัตรา

กำหนดค่า Wordfence Brute Force Protection

  • ไปที่ Wordfence →ไฟร์วอลล์→ การป้องกันกำลังดุร้าย
  • เปิดใช้งานพยายาม จำกัด การเข้าสู่ระบบและป้องกันชื่อผู้ใช้“ admin”
  • กำหนดการตั้งค่าเหล่านี้เพื่อรักษาความปลอดภัยพื้นที่ WP admin ของคุณ

ดูบันทึกของสแปมบอทที่ถูกบล็อก – เมื่อคุณกำหนดค่า Wordfence เพื่อบล็อกบอทที่ไม่ดีคุณจะเห็นการเข้าสู่ระบบของบอททั้งหมดที่ถูกบล็อกจากเว็บไซต์ของคุณชื่อโฮสต์และจำนวนบล็อกของพวกเขา.

Wordfence-Firewall ปิดกั้น

5. บล็อกบ็อตที่ไม่ดีด้วยกฎไฟร์วอลล์ Cloudflare

กฎไฟร์วอลล์ Cloudflare ช่วยให้คุณสามารถบล็อกชื่อโฮสต์ได้สูงสุด 5 ชื่อบนแผนฟรี.

เข้าสู่ระบบแดชบอร์ด Cloudflare ของคุณและไปที่ไฟร์วอลล์→กฎไฟร์วอลล์→สร้างกฎไฟร์วอลล์ คัดลอกชื่อโฮสต์ของ bot ที่ไม่ดี (จาก Wordfence) และเพิ่มที่นี่ในฟิลด์“ ค่า” เนื่องจากคุณสามารถสร้าง 5 กฎได้คุณจะทำซ้ำขั้นตอนนี้สำหรับบอทที่แย่ที่สุด 5 ตัวจาก Wordfence.

  • ฟิลด์ = ชื่อโฮสต์
  • ผู้ประกอบการ = ประกอบด้วย
  • ค่า = ชื่อโฮสต์ของบอตที่ไม่ถูกต้องที่คุณพบใน Wordfence

กฎไฟร์วอลล์ Cloudflare เพื่อบล็อกบอทที่ไม่ดี

คุณสามารถเห็นบอทที่ถูกบล็อกโดย Cloudflare ในแท็บเหตุการณ์ไฟร์วอลล์:

Cloudflare-Firewall-เหตุการณ์

6. ติดตั้งปลั๊กอิน Blackhole For Bad Bots

Blackhole For Bad Bots plugin หยุดบอทที่ไม่ดีโดยการเพิ่มลิงค์ทริกเกอร์ที่ซ่อนอยู่ในส่วนท้ายของเว็บไซต์ของคุณที่บอกให้บอทไม่ต้องติดตาม หากพวกเขาทำเช่นนั้นพวกเขาจะถูกบล็อกทันทีจากเว็บไซต์ของคุณ บอตที่ถูกกฎหมายใด ๆ (เช่น Googlebot) จะปฏิบัติตามกฎของคุณและจะไม่ถูกบล็อก.

Blackhole สำหรับ Bad Bots

ขั้นตอนที่ 1: ติดตั้งปลั๊กอิน Blackhole For Bad Bots.

ขั้นตอนที่ 2: ในการตั้งค่าปลั๊กอินให้คัดลอกกฎของ Robots.

Blackhole-Robots กฎ

ขั้นตอนที่ 3: เพิ่มกฎของหุ่นยนต์ในไฟล์ robots.txt ของคุณ.

Blachole-Robots-txt

ขั้นตอนที่ 4: เมื่อคุณเพิ่มกฎไปที่หน้าแรกของคุณและดูซอร์สโค้ด ค้นหาคำว่า “blackhole” และคุณจะเห็นลิงค์ที่สร้างโดยปลั๊กอิน ควรมีลักษณะเช่นนี้:

อย่าไปตามลิงค์นี้มิฉะนั้นคุณจะถูกแบนจากเว็บไซต์!

ขั้นตอนที่ 5: ในการตั้งค่า“ Bad Bots” ของปลั๊กอินคุณสามารถดูบอททั้งหมดที่ถูกบล็อก.

Blackhole-ถูกบล็อคบอท

7. ย้ายหน้าล็อกอิน WP ของคุณ

บอทที่ไม่ดีบางตัวจะพยายามเข้าถึงหน้า wp-login ของคุณ แม้ว่าพวกเขาจะไม่สามารถเข้าถึงพวกเขาจะยังคงพยายามหลายครั้งซึ่งเป็นการสิ้นเปลืองทรัพยากรเซิร์ฟเวอร์ เนื่องจากบอทสแปมส่วนใหญ่จะไม่ซับซ้อนการย้ายหน้าเข้าสู่ระบบ WP ของคุณควรช่วยป้องกันไม่ให้บอทชนเข้ากับมัน.

วิธีการ

เปลี่ยนเข้าสู่ระบบ-URL

8. พยายาม จำกัด การเข้าสู่ระบบ

การ จำกัด ความพยายามในการเข้าสู่ระบบจะล็อคผู้ใช้และบอทด้วยการพยายามเข้าสู่ระบบที่ล้มเหลวมากเกินไปในหน้า wp-login ของคุณ นี่เป็นอีกวิธีหนึ่งที่ช่วยป้องกันบอทสแปมจากการเข้าชมไซต์ของคุณมากเกินไป.

วิธีการ

Wordfence ขีด จำกัด -เข้าสู่ระบบ

คำถามที่พบบ่อย

&# x1f47e; บอทที่เลวร้ายอะไรกันแน่?

บอทที่ไม่ดีคือบอทใด ๆ ที่เข้ามาที่เว็บไซต์ของคุณโดยไม่มีผลประโยชน์ใด ๆ นำไปสู่การสิ้นเปลืองทรัพยากรเซิร์ฟเวอร์และอาจทำให้ข้อมูล Google Analytics เบ้.

&# x1f47e; ฉันจะตรวจสอบว่าบอทที่ไม่ดีกำลังเข้าชมไซต์ของฉันได้อย่างไร?

รายงานการเข้าชมสดของ Wordfence แสดงให้คุณเห็นบอตทั้งหมดที่เข้าชมเว็บไซต์ของคุณแบบเรียลไทม์ ที่นี่คุณสามารถตรวจสอบว่ามีบอทที่น่าสงสัยเข้าชมเว็บไซต์ของคุณหรือไม่.

&# x1f47e; ฉันจะปิดกั้นพวกเขาได้อย่างไร?

คุณสามารถบล็อกได้ในการตั้งค่าการบล็อกและการ จำกัด อัตราของ Wordfence อีกทางเลือกหนึ่งถ้าคุณไม่ต้องการใช้ Wordfence ให้คุณบล็อกชื่อโฮสต์ 5 ชื่อโดยใช้กฎไฟร์วอลล์ Cloudflare หรือติดตั้งปลั๊กอิน Blackhole For Bad Bots.

&# x1f47e; ฉันควรใช้ Wordfence เพื่อป้องกันบอทที่ไม่ดี?

ใช้ Wordfence เฉพาะเมื่อคุณรู้ว่าคุณกำลังทำอะไรและสามารถกำหนดการตั้งค่าได้อย่างสะดวกสบาย มีตัวเลือกการบล็อกที่ยอดเยี่ยมและสามารถหยุดบอทที่ไม่ดีได้เกือบทุกตัว แต่การกำหนดค่าที่ไม่ถูกต้องอาจบล็อกโปรแกรมรวบรวมข้อมูลที่ถูกกฎหมายและแม้แต่ผู้เยี่ยมชมที่เป็นมนุษย์.

&# x1f47e; ปลั๊กอินตัวไหนดีที่สุดสำหรับการหยุดบอทที่ไม่ดี?

ปลั๊กอิน Blackhole For Bad Bots ทำงานได้อย่างยอดเยี่ยมในการหยุดบ็อตที่ไม่ดีโดยเพิ่มลิงก์ทริกเกอร์ที่ซ่อนอยู่ในส่วนท้ายของเว็บไซต์ของคุณเพื่อบอกบอตไม่ให้ติดตามลิงก์ หากพวกเขาทำเช่นนั้นพวกเขาจะถูกแบน.

ฉันหวังว่าคู่มือนี้จะเป็นประโยชน์และคุณสามารถปิดกั้นบ็อตที่น่ารำคาญเหล่านั้นได้! หากคุณมีคำถามใด ๆ ให้ฉันแสดงความคิดเห็นด้านล่างและฉันจะกลับไปหาคุณทันทีที่ฉันสามารถ.

ดูสิ่งนี้ด้วย: ฉันจะได้คะแนน GTmetrix 100% ได้อย่างไร

ไชโย,

ทอม

Jeffrey Wilson Administrator
Sorry! The Author has not filled his profile.
follow me
    Like this post? Please share to your friends:
    Adblock
    detector
    map